BREXIT


Hi, it’s Deborah and Euzi





The Home Office has announced that EU, EEA and Swiss citizens will continue to prove their right to rent in the UK by showing their passport or national identity card, as they currently do, until 1 January 2021, including in a no-deal scenario...

FRAUD


Hi, it’s Deborah and Euzi




The owner and director of the Meat Shack Ltd in Studley has been sentenced to two years and nine months in jail by Warwick Crown Court for fraudulent trading and making false representations. The business advertised in newspapers and in its shop that its meat was British in origin, when in fact the company was buying large quantities of its meat overseas...
